WebFeb 11, 2024 · An IgE test is a blood test that detects circulating IgE. The test includes two types of test: Testing for total IgE — the total level of IgE in the blood. Testing for specific IgE — the level of specific IgE against a particular allergen. Total IgE and specific IgE tests can be ordered at the same time or independently.
